Откликайтесь
на вакансии с ИИ

Senior Fullstack Engineer (Go/TypeScript)
Отличная вакансия в известной продуктовой компании с успешным мировым хитом. Четкий стек технологий и удаленный формат работы делают предложение очень привлекательным для опытных инженеров.
Сложность вакансии
Высокая сложность обусловлена требованием глубокой экспертизы сразу в двух стеках (Go и TypeScript) на уровне Senior, а также знанием архитектурных паттернов DDD и SOLID.
Анализ зарплаты
Зарплата в вакансии не указана, но для позиции Senior Fullstack (Go/TS) в международной игровой компании рыночные ожидания обычно находятся в верхнем диапазоне. Предложенные оценки отражают текущий уровень компенсаций для специалистов такого уровня в Европе и РФ.
Сопроводительное письмо
Составьте идеальное письмо к вакансии с ИИ-агентом

Откликнитесь в X-FLOW уже сейчас
Присоединяйтесь к команде создателей Happy Color и развивайте высоконагруженные игровые сервисы на Go и TypeScript!
Описание вакансии
Senior Fullstack Engineer (Go/TypeScript) / X-FLOW
Remote
X-FLOW is a mobile game development company established in 2018. We gained recognition after the release of Happy Color, the most popular digital coloring book.
Требования к кандидату:
- 3+ years of commercial development experience
- 3+ years with Golang and 3+ years with TypeScript
- Proficient in Go: context handling, concurrency, gRPC/REST
- Strong frontend skills with TypeScript: React, Redux Toolkit
- Databases: PostgreSQL/MySQL, Redis; design, indexing
- Queues/Buses: Kafka/NATS
- CI/CD: GitLab CI, feature flags, migrations
- Testing: Jest, Playwright
- Security: OAuth2, JWT
- Understanding of DDD principles, SOLID
- Technology Stack: Go, TypeScript, React, PostgreSQL, Redis
Читать подробнее:
Создайте идеальное резюме с помощью ИИ-агента

Навыки
- Go
- TypeScript
- React
- Redux Toolkit
- PostgreSQL
- MySQL
- Redis
- Kafka
- NATS
- GitLab CI
- Jest
- Playwright
- gRPC
- REST
- OAuth2
- JWT
- DDD
- SOLID
Возможные вопросы на собеседовании
Проверка понимания работы с конкурентностью в Go, что критично для игровых бэкендов.
Расскажите, как вы подходите к проектированию конкурентных систем в Go и в каких случаях предпочтете использование mutex вместо каналов?
Оценка навыков проектирования баз данных и оптимизации запросов.
Как бы вы спроектировали систему индексов в PostgreSQL для таблицы с миллионами записей, где часто выполняются сложные фильтрации?
Проверка опыта работы с современным фронтенд-стеком.
В чем преимущества использования Redux Toolkit по сравнению с классическим Redux, и как вы организуете побочные эффекты в приложении?
Оценка архитектурного мышления.
Можете ли вы привести пример реализации принципов DDD в вашем последнем проекте? С какими сложностями вы столкнулись?
Проверка навыков обеспечения качества и тестирования.
Как вы распределяете покрытие тестами между Jest и Playwright в своих проектах? Какую стратегию тестирования считаете оптимальной для Fullstack-приложения?
Похожие вакансии
Senior fullstack developer (Node.js + React.js)
Senior Full-Stack developer (node.js)
LegalTech Python / Fullstack разработчик
Full-stack Developer High-Middle / Senior
Fullstack Разработчик Senior
Senior fullstack developer
1000+ офферов получено
Устали искать работу? Мы найдём её за вас
Quick Offer улучшит ваше резюме, подберёт лучшие вакансии и откликнется за вас. Результат — в 3 раза больше приглашений на собеседования и никакой рутины!